Why Professional Cat Flap Installation Matters
You may be lured to grab a drill and deal with cat flap installation yourself. While some DIY lovers might successfully manage, there are compelling reasons to entrust this task to a professional:
- Expertise and Experience: Professional installers have the understanding and practical experience to manage different door and wall types. They understand the complexities of different products like wood, glass, UPVC, brick, and even metal, and understand the proper tools and methods for each.
- Accurate Cutting and Fitting: Accurate measurements and accurate cutting are critical for a weathertight and safe and secure cat flap. Specialists have actually the specialized tools to cut clean, straight openings, making sure a tight fit that prevents drafts, water ingress, and unwanted insects.
- Door and Wall Integrity: Improper installation can harm your door or wall. Experts understand structural stability and will install the cat flap without compromising the security or insulation of your home. They can likewise encourage on the best place and type of small cat flap installation flap for your particular structure.
- Warranty and Guarantees: Many reputable installers offer warranties on their craftsmanship. This supplies assurance, understanding that if any issues emerge due to the installation, they will rectify them. DIY setups, naturally, featured no such guarantees.
- Time and Convenience: Let’s admit it, everybody’s time is important. Hiring a professional releases you from the trouble of research, tool procurement, and the actual installation process itself. They can complete the job effectively, typically in a fraction of the time it would take a newbie.
- Specialized Installations: For more complex setups, such as fitting a cat flap into glass doors, double glazing, or walls, professional know-how is generally essential. These require specific tools and understanding to avoid harming the glass or structural aspects.
- Visual Considerations: A professional installer will take note of information and make sure the cat flap is installed neatly and visually pleasing. They can advise on placement and even provide trims or finishes to blend the flap effortlessly with your door or wall.

The Cat Flap Installation Process: What to Expect
While the specifics can vary, the basic installation process usually involves these steps:
- Initial Consultation and Quote: Contact the installer to discuss your requirements, door type, cat flap choices, and get a quote. Some installers might offer on-site assessments to assess the task in person.
- Arranging an Appointment: Once you’ve concurred on a quote and chosen an installer, you’ll arrange a hassle-free installation date and time.
- Preparation: Before the installer gets here, make sure the area around the door or wall is clear. If you have a particular place in mind, ensure it’s accessible.
- Installation: The installer will show up with the needed tools and products. They will:
- Mark the Cut-Out Area: Precisely procedure and mark the location on the door or wall for cutting.
- Cut the Opening: Using proper tools, thoroughly cut the opening for the cat flap.
- Prepare the Opening: Ensure the edges of the cut are tidy and smooth.
- Install the Cat Flap: Fit the cat flap into the opening and protect it according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
- Seal and Finish: Seal around the cat flap to prevent drafts and water ingress. They might also include trims or finishing touches for a neater look.
- Testing and Demonstration: The installer will evaluate the cat flap to guarantee it opens and closes smoothly. They might also demonstrate its operation to you.
- Clean Up: A professional installer will tidy up any debris or mess created during the installation process.
- Payment and Warranty: You’ll normally pay upon completion. Ensure you get any service warranty details or paperwork.
Cost Considerations
The cost of cat flap installation can differ depending upon a number of factors:
- Type of Cat Flap: Basic manual flaps are less expensive to install than microchip or electronic models, which may need wiring.
- Door/Wall Material: Installation into wood is generally less pricey than glass, brick, or metal, which might need specific tools and techniques.
- Intricacy of Installation: If the installation is simple (e.g., into a standard wooden door), it will likely be less expensive than a more complex job (e.g., through a thick wall or double glazing).
- Installer’s Rates: Different installers will have various rates based upon their experience, overheads, and area.
- Area: Installation costs can vary geographically, with prices frequently being higher in major cities.
It’s always recommended to get quotes from at least 3 different installers to compare costs and services before making a decision.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: Can I install a cat flap myself?A: Yes, for standard setups into easy wood doors, a DIY technique is possible for those with good DIY abilities. However, for more complex installations or if you do not have confidence, professional installation is extremely recommended.
Q: How long does cat flap installation take?A: A typical cat flap installation can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ours, depending upon the door type, intricacy of the installation, and the installer’s performance.
Q: Will a cat flap make my home less secure?A: modern cat flap installation cat flaps, especially microchip and magnetic versions, are developed to boost security. Guarantee you pick a trustworthy brand name and think about security features when choosing your flap. Professional installation likewise contributes to security by ensuring a proper fit.
Q: Can a cat flap be set up in glass?A: Yes, cat flaps can be set up in glass, including single and double glazing. Nevertheless, this needs specialized tools and know-how. Constantly use a professional glass cat flap installer for glass installations.
Q: What type of cat flap is best for security?A: Microchip cat flaps are generally considered the most safe and secure cat flap installation as they only permit access to cats with signed up microchips, avoiding undesirable animals from going into.
Q: How much does cat flap installation normally cost?A: Costs can differ, but you can usually expect to pay in between ₤ 80 to ₤ 250 (or local currency equivalent) for professional cat flap installation, depending on the aspects discussed earlier. Get quotes from numerous installers for an accurate price quote.
Q: Do I require to offer the cat flap, or does the installer?A: This differs. Some installers will supply the cat flap as part of their service, providing a choice of options. Others may choose you to acquire the cat flap yourself. Clarify this with the installer when getting a quote.
Q: What if my cat does not use the cat flap after installation?A: Patience is key. Motivate your cat to use the flap with deals with and favorable support. You can likewise initially prop the flap open or utilize pet-friendly training sprays. Many felines adapt to using cat flaps relatively quickly.
